Course Overview

The Business Economics Bachelor of Science at Shorelight University of Central Florida equips you with specialized economic training and core business administration skills. You will develop a unique perspective to help companies improve decision-making and understand the consequences of their actions, exploring areas like quantitative business tools, financial management, and marketing. This program is designed for students interested in understanding the intricate relationship between economic principles and business strategy, preparing you to analyze complex markets and contribute to organizational success. You will build a solid foundation in economics and gain practical business acumen.

This undergraduate degree is studied full-time on campus over four years, blending foundational economic theory with practical business applications. You will delve into intermediate microeconomics and macroeconomics, alongside quantitative methods and business research, with the flexibility to choose from a range of restricted electives such as econometrics, international economics, or business analytics. Throughout your studies, you will develop critical thinking, data analysis, and report writing skills. You will graduate prepared for diverse career paths in business, finance, government, or to pursue further graduate studies in economics or public administration.

Program Overview

This course explores the fundamental principles of business economics, integrating core business functions with economic theory. Students will delve into microeconomic and macroeconomic concepts, applying them to real-world business scenarios. The curriculum also offers a range of specialized electives, allowing for deeper exploration of topics such as econometrics, international economics, and labor economics.

1 Core Requirements

Accounting for decision-makers
Quantitative business tools II
Business finance
Management of organizations
Marketing
Introduction to career development and financial plannings
Career search strategy
Legal and ethical environment of business
Supply chain and operations management
Business interviewing techniques
Executing your career plan
Business research for decision making

2 Major Requirements

Intermediate microeconomics
Intermediate macroeconomics

3 Restricted Electives

Money and banking
Mathematical economics
International microeconomics
Seminar on current economic topics
Labor economics
Environmental and natural resource economics
Industrial organization
Development economics
Topics in econometrics
Health economics
Game theory and economics
Introduction to business analytics
Econometrics I
Econometrics II
Public economics
International macroeconomics
Economics of sports
Law and economics
Advanced topics in international economics
Thinking like an economist
Python for business analytics

What English language score do I need for this course?

To enroll, you must meet specific English language requirements. Acceptable test scores include a TOEFL overall score of 80, an IELTS overall score of 6.5, or a Duolingo score of 120.
